Are Big Age Gaps in K-Dramas Romantic or Problematic?

Age-gap romances in K-dramas often spark discussion, but they do not always bring the controversy people expect. Over time, audiences have seen that strong acting, believable chemistry, and thoughtful storytelling can make an age difference fade into the background. When those elements click, the story becomes more about the connection between characters than the years separating them.

A prime example is 'Goblin'. On paper, the gap between Gong Yoo’s immortal character and Kim Go Eun’s high school student character is significant. Yet the emotional depth, layered personalities, and captivating performances drew viewers in. For many, it became a global sensation that outshone any concerns about the characters’ ages. Still, some viewers could not ignore the difference, with a few describing the dynamic as unsettling and questioning whether it crossed a line.

Other series have faced similar attention, though for different reasons. 'Crash Course in Romance' featured characters who were supposed to be close in age within the story, but the real-life decade gap between Jung Kyung Ho and Jeon Do Yeon drew criticism from some who felt the two lacked romantic chemistry. Likewise, 'Cinderella at 2AM' delivered a playful and charming plot, but some viewers felt the large gap between the leads was still noticeable and affected how the romance came across.

In South Korea, where age hierarchy and respect for generational boundaries are deeply rooted in the culture, noticeable age gaps can sometimes feel awkward. Whether an age-gap romance feels magical or uncomfortable often comes down to the writing, the characters’ relationship dynamics, and the personal perspectives of the audience. When handled with care, these romances can become memorable and touching. But when the execution misses the mark, the age difference can overshadow the story entirely.

In the end, age-gap romances in K-dramas are as varied as the stories themselves. When the writing, acting, and emotional beats align, the age difference can fade into the background, leaving viewers with a heartfelt connection to the characters. But when those elements fall short, the gap becomes the story’s loudest detail. As long as these dramas continue to spark conversation, they will remain a fascinating, if sometimes divisive, part of the K-drama landscape.
